Output f62f381134e36b1e86266c1b7ff837b7d3255bfd4add96a9aaeb107123943872:0

value
860491
script pubkey
OP_0 OP_PUSHBYTES_20 f9f583b4754c96b33ae614d9271910a1399205c6
address
tb1ql86c8dr4fjttxwhxznvjwxgs5yueypwxdwq638
transaction
f62f381134e36b1e86266c1b7ff837b7d3255bfd4add96a9aaeb107123943872
confirmations
68459
spent
true